Cheryl LeBlanc Hebert, 58 years old, died on Saturday, January 30, 2016, as a result of an automobile accident.
She is survived by her husband, Gary Hebert; one son and daughter-in-law, Blake and Ashely Aucoin Hebert; one grandson, Gavin Hebert; one sister and brother-in-law, Wanda and Derrell Haydel; one niece, Ashley Cavalier; one great niece, Kaylee Hebert; step dad, Tom Simoneaux and his wife, Kathleen Simoneaux.
Preceded in death by her parents, Edmond LeBlanc and Alice LeBlanc Simoneaux.
Her greatest love was spending time with her family and taking care of her grandson.
Visitation will be held on Thursday, February 4, 2016 at 8:30 a.m. until Mass of Christian Burial at 11:00 a.m. at St. Elizabeth Catholic Church in Paincourtville. Entombment to follow in church mausoleum. Arrangements by Ourso Funeral Home in Donaldsonville.
